1. Automating business processes

An Analytics Insight survey shows that 80% of retail executives anticipate their businesses to implement AI automation by 2025. Adopting new technologies such as robotic process automation (RPA) and intelligent process automation (IPA) is now an integral aspect of a solid business strategy. These innovations provide several benefits, including increased productivity, higher production rates, and better service quality.

AI and machine learning solutions can help speed up business processes by performing repetitive yet simple tasks. By automating and optimizing routine processes and tasks, businesses can save time and money while improving operational efficiency and productivity. Many skilled workers are concerned about job security as AI gets more integrated into company processes, but automation is not designed to replace human labor. Instead, experts predict the workforce will grow increasingly specialized. These roles will need a greater level of creativity, problem-solving, and qualitative skills — which automation cannot currently offer.

Essentially, there will always be a need for people in the workforce, but their responsibilities may change as technology advances. Many of these new roles will require more sophisticated technical skills.

4. Streamlining the sales process

By leveraging powerful algorithms and comprehensive insights, AI-enabled sales solutions may improve decision-making, sales rep productivity, and the effectiveness of sales processes. When combined with a well-conceived strategy, AI promises to elevate the sales process. Ranging from prospecting and forecasting to upselling and cross-selling.

As discussed earlier, AI can collect past customer behavior and real-time data to identify patterns and accurately forecast sales. Using lead scoring tools, businesses can rate the sales readiness of a prospect by assigning points to various customer interactions. Based on a range of lead scores set for each stage, sales teams can quickly determine where a customer falls within the buyer’s journey. The sales team can also use historical data to predict how long it will take for each prospect to move through the sales funnel. 

Moreover, AI helps sales reps save time and increase productivity. By using AI to handle repetitive, low-return tasks like tracking activities and qualifying leads, the sales team can focus on building relationships with high-opportunity, sales-ready prospects and bringing in more money for the business.
